Abstract

In this paper we are hiding data into two different ways one is data hiding before encryption and other is data hiding after encryption. We are hiding the data into the image by using data hiding key firstly before encryption and then hiding the data into the image after encryption. At the receiver side the original image can be recovered by providing the same key for decryption as done in encryption in order to get the hidden data. Comparison of two retrieved image is done by the PSNR. The results of data hiding after the encryption are much better than that of data hiding into the image before encryption. The embedding rate is also increased by 2.23% using data hiding after encryption than data hiding before encryption.
